Letter from Secretary of Theodore Roosevelt to George E. Vincent

On behalf of Theodore Roosevelt, his secretary informs George E. Vincent that Roosevelt would consider Herbert Knox Smith perfectly acceptable as a speaker (presumably in lieu of Roosevelt). However, if Knox accepted Vincent’s invitation, he would not be speaking officially for Roosevelt.
